The Omran Center for Strategic Studies, in cooperation with the Middle East Foundation and Istanbul Sabahattin Zaim University, is pleased to announce the organization of the symposium entitled “Post-Conflict Reconstruction in Syria", in Istanbul on 29–30 November 2025.
This symposium aims to approach international development and post-conflict reconstruction from an interdisciplinary perspective. By bringing together academics, policymakers, and practitioners, it seeks to develop guiding frameworks and strategies for the future of Syria’s reconstruction process.
Main Themes
Inclusive Governance and Institutional Rebuilding
Geopolitics, International Cooperation, and Lessons Learned
Humanitarian Development
Economic Recovery and Infrastructure
Social Cohesion and Cultural Heritage Preservation
Urban Planning and Architecture
Security Debates and Peacebuilding
Law and Transitional Justice
Refugees and Diaspora
Date, Venue, and Languages
Date: 29–30 November 2025
Venue: Istanbul Sabahattin Zaim University, Istanbul
Languages: Turkish, English, and Arabic
Selected papers will be published in a special issue of the Turkish Journal of International Development (TUJID).
